Ride for the right to adventure

The money you raise will help to keep riders off the roads and restore multi-user routes that can be enjoyed by everyone. With hundreds of horse and rider injuries on the road reported to us each year, it is more vital than ever to ensure safe off-road access for equestrians.

Meet Fleur and her horse, Taz

Hi, I’m Fleur and I completed Rideathon last year in memory of my father. I also wanted to give back to the BHS for their support of our project. I am part of the Tamar Trails Riding Association and with the kind grant from the BHS, we were able to transform a disused car park into a smart, safe horse-transport-only car park. The new parking gives equestrians safe access to 25km of stunning multi-use tracks.

Taking part in Rideathon was so enjoyable but a true challenge as well. Where we live in Devon is so hilly, so a huge effort for Taz, my 17-year 16.3 Irish Draught. He is the true star in all of this; he carried me safely to achieve 100 miles, and we raised over £1,000 so the BHS can support more projects like ours!
